Argos

Argos, an British catalog retailer established in 1973, was acquired by Sainsbury’s supermarket chain in 2016 The company offers a full range of general merchandise through its websites and apps, stores and convenient Click & Collect points within Sainsbury's supermarkets. The company also offers the industry-leading Fast Track home delivery service that covers 90 percent of UK postcodes.

Argos, a multichannel retail brand, has taken a vow to improve customer experience at its stores. It has, for example changed its laminated catalogs with tablets, and created a digital kiosk which allows customers to buy goods in just two easy steps. This has enabled the company to offer customers a simpler shopping experience, and to increase the speed at which products are available to pick up.

The company has also enhanced its search engine optimization and boosted its social media presence. The company's traffic on its website has grown dramatically over the last year. The website of the company is the second most popular online store in the United Kingdom after Amazon. The company also launched an app for mobiles, which allows customers to browse and purchase products while on the move.

In addition to its vast online catalog, Argos has a network of more than 100 locations across the UK. The store's click-and-collect service allows customers to buy items on the internet and pick them up at the nearest location within four hours. Additionally, the company provides free home delivery for all orders of more than PS50 and an exclusive "Fast Track" service that assures that customers receive their purchases on the same day.

In addition, Argos has a number of useful features on its product pages, such as the search tool that will show customers all nearby stores where they can find the item they are looking for. Argos also utilizes reviews that customers provide to improve the product selection process.

Selfridges

Selfridges is a fantastic place to shop for high-end fashion and beauty brands. The department store chain, located in London is famous for its unique windows displays. The principal store of the chain is located on Oxford Street, a popular shopping area. The company operates a variety of regional stores. The online store is stocked with the latest fashion, beauty, and lifestyle brands.

Harry Gordon Selfridge wanted to revolutionize shopping when he opened his department store on Oxford Street in 1909. He wanted to attract customers to his store with captivating display. His idea worked - his shop became an attraction that people from all over world came to.

Selfridges continues to develop and adapt to the times. Recently, it launched a clothing-rental service similar to Rent the Runway that addresses an emerging trend in retail. The company also provides a variety of services for customers, such as free returns and a in-store beauty consultation.

The online store is simple to navigate and offers many options that include both popular brands and lesser-known brands. Selfridges has a mobile application that allows you to find what you're looking for. The company also has a loyalty program which provides customers with points for each purchase.

Selfridges, although not as big as its rivals in the UK market, is still a major player. The company also plans to open a flagship store within Birmingham's re-energized Bull Ring district and has been exploring potential locations in Glasgow and Newcastle. Selfridges continues to reinvent itself and remains profitable despite the challenges that traditional retailers face.

John Lewis

John Lewis, a high-end department store, has an array of clothing brands like Whistles and Paul Smith as well as furniture and home accessories like from Loaf and online shopping sites in united kingdom Duresta. Its electronics selection includes the most modern TVs from LG and Apple as well as dryers, washing machines vacuum cleaners and more. The retailer is also known for its heartwarming Christmas advertisements.

John Lewis has been expanding its online presence in recent years. John Lewis has joined forces with ACI Worldwide to ensure secure and smooth checkouts for its customers.
